Rik Emmett And David Pack Join Yamaha Handcrafted Acoustic Guitar Ad Campaign -Virtuosos Eager to Share Their Appreciation of Yamaha Guitars- Two respected artists from both sides of the border have signed on to represent Yamaha Handcrafted Acoustic Guitars. Rik Emmett, one of Canada's premier musicians, and David Pack, veteran singer-songwriter and Grammy® Award-winning producer, will be featured in Yamaha's new ad campaign promoting the guitars' superior look, feel and tone. Pack has been a fixture on the American music scene since he came to prominence in the 1970s with the California rock band Ambrosia. He has established himself as one of the industry's key composers and producers, heading projects for Disney, DreamWorks, Kenny Loggins, Linda Ronstadt, Michael McDonald and others. Pack won Grammy® and Dove awards in 1997 for producing Tribute: Songs of Andrae Crouch, produced and arranged a 1996 tribute album of Leonard Bernstein's songs from West Side Story and served as musical director for both of President Clinton's inaugurations. Though Ambrosia's last album was released in 1982, the group still tours, and has produced a greatest hits album with three new tracks which Pack wrote and produced. Emmett has just released Raw Quartet, the final installment in a trilogy of albums that began with 1997's Ten Invitations from the Mistress of Mr. E and continued with 1998's Swing Shift. Like David Pack, his earliest widespread success came as a band member in the 1970s, first with glam-rock group Justin Paige and later with Triumph. Since leaving that band in 1988 he has produced six solo albums, contributed regularly to Guitar Player magazine, drawn cartoons for Hit Parader magazine and written a four-volume set of guitar instruction books entitled For the Love of the Guitar. Emmett serves on the Board of Directors of the Songwriters Association of Canada, and is chairman of the Advisory Board for Humber College's music program. Emmett has been playing a variety of Yamaha guitars, including Pacifica solid-bodies, AEX arch-tops and even high-end classical guitars, for the past fifteen years.
